Uploading models

We have a guide here. If you are using PyTorch, you can even leverage the PyTorchModelHubMixin class which adds from_pretrained and push_to_hub methods to your model, making it very easy for others to use.

Uploading datasets

It would also be great to make the discovered configurations (like the circle packings or sphere packings) available on the 🤗 hub so that people can load them with:

from datasets import load_dataset
dataset = load_dataset("your-hf-org-or-username/your-dataset")

Besides that, there's the dataset viewer which allows people to explore the geometric data directly in the browser.
